Countering the air shot

Tepano is considered by some to be the best character in Head Basketball. His jump shot is particularly challenging to defend against, and his air shot inflicts more damage than any other power shot in the game.

To counter Tepano's air shot, you must first understand how it works. When Tepano throws the ball, a golem appears in front of the opponent's net. The golem jumps, catches the ball, and immediately dunks it before self-destructing. As the golem jumps, it spits out a stream of lava that covers a wide area, from the centre of the court to the net board. The ball flies in a straight line through the middle of the lava stream, making it very hard to locate and counter.

To successfully counter this move, you must focus on blocking the ball in the air. If you can block the ball, the lava will no longer cause any damage. Upgrading your character's Jump, Speed, and Dash abilities can help you get to the ball more easily. However, keep in mind that even if you successfully counter the attack, you might not deal any damage to Tepano. Countering Tepano's air shot requires a combination of patience, luck, and quick reflexes.

Upgrading jump, speed, and dash

To counter Tepano in Head Basketball, it is recommended to upgrade your character's jump, speed, and dash abilities. These attributes determine your character's mobility, allowing them to move faster and reach the ball more easily. Upgrading jump, speed, and dash can be particularly effective when performing counters, which are special moves that require your opponent to use their own special move first.

When facing Tepano, their special move involves teleporting under their net and summoning a golem that spits out a stream of lava. The lava stream covers a wide area, from the center of the court to the net board, and the ball flies in a straight line within this stream. If your character comes into contact with the stream, they will be burned and immobilized. Therefore, upgrading your character's speed can help them escape the lava stream more quickly and reduce the chance of being burned.

Additionally, Tepano's golem can be challenging to counter because the ball is difficult to locate within the lava stream. Upgrading your character's jump ability can help them reach higher and potentially block the ball in the air. This is especially useful if you time your jump correctly and manage to hit the stream without getting burned, as you can then get closer to the ball and swing, disrupting Tepano's attack.

Furthermore, dash upgrades can also improve your character's responsiveness, enabling them to change directions swiftly and adjust their position as needed to counter Tepano's unpredictable moves. While upgrading jump, speed, and dash can enhance your character's mobility, keep in mind that counters also require precise timing and a bit of luck to successfully execute against Tepano's powerful attacks.
